:root{--text:#6b6375;--text-h:#08060d;--bg-color:#fff;--bg-sidebar:#fbfbfa;--text-color:#37352f;--text-muted:#37352fa6;--border-color:#37352f17;--hover-bg:#37352f14;--accent-color:#37352f;--accent-text:#fff;--danger:#eb5757;--success:#000;--radius:4px;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Helvetica,Apple Color Emoji,Arial,sans-serif,Segoe UI Emoji,Segoe UI Symbol;font-weight:400;line-height:1.5}[data-theme=dark]{filter:invert()hue-rotate(180deg)}[data-theme=dark] body,[data-theme=dark] #root{background-color:#000!important}[data-theme=dark] .card{filter:none;background-color:#1a1a1a!important}[data-theme=dark] img,[data-theme=dark] svg{filter:invert()hue-rotate(180deg)}[data-theme=dark] .input,[data-theme=dark] .textarea,[data-theme=dark] .select{color:#fff;background-color:#1a1a1a}body{background-color:var(--bg-color);color:var(--text-color);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;margin:0}*{box-sizing:border-box;margin:0;padding:0}.input,.textarea,.select{border-radius:var(--radius);width:100%;color:var(--text-color);background:0 0;border:1px solid #0000;padding:.375rem .5rem;font-family:inherit;font-size:.875rem;transition:all .2s;box-shadow:inset 0 0 0 1px #0f0f0f1a}.input:focus,.textarea:focus,.select:focus{outline:none;box-shadow:inset 0 0 0 2px #2eaadc80}.btn{border-radius:var(--radius);cursor:pointer;background:0 0;border:none;justify-content:center;align-items:center;gap:.375rem;padding:.25rem .75rem;font-size:.875rem;font-weight:500;transition:background .12s ease-in;display:inline-flex}.btn:hover{background:var(--hover-bg)}.btn-primary{background:var(--accent-color);color:var(--accent-text);box-shadow:0 1px 2px #0f0f0f1a}.btn-primary:hover{background:var(--accent-color);opacity:.9;color:var(--accent-text)}.card{border:1px solid var(--border-color);border-radius:var(--radius);background:var(--bg-color);border:none;padding:1rem;transition:box-shadow .2s;box-shadow:0 0 0 1px #0f0f0f0d,0 2px 4px #0f0f0f1a}body{background-color:var(--bg-color);color:var(--text-color);margin:0}h1,h2,h3,h4,h5,h6{color:var(--text-h);margin:0}p{color:var(--text);margin:0}.sidebar-container{z-index:10;background-color:var(--bg-sidebar);width:250px;height:100vh;transition:transform .3s;position:fixed;top:0;left:0}.main-content{min-height:100vh;margin-left:250px;transition:margin .3s}.mobile-only{display:none!important}@media (width<=768px){.sidebar-container{width:280px;transform:translate(-100%)}.sidebar-container.open{transform:translate(0)}.main-content{margin-left:0;padding:80px 1rem 1.5rem!important}.mobile-only{display:flex!important}h1{font-size:28px!important}.page-header{flex-direction:column!important;align-items:flex-start!important;gap:1rem!important}.page-header>div:last-child{width:100%!important;margin-top:.5rem!important}}.kanban-container{-webkit-overflow-scrolling:touch;gap:1.5rem;padding-bottom:1rem;display:flex;overflow-x:auto}.kanban-column{flex-shrink:0;min-width:280px}.stats-grid{grid-template-columns:repeat(auto-fit,minmax(200px,1fr));gap:1.5rem;display:grid}@media (width<=480px){.stats-grid{grid-template-columns:1fr}.card{padding:1rem!important}}
